A veterinary clinic in Nottingham is seeking a Veterinary Surgeon to join their skilled team on a 3-month fixed term contract. The ideal candidate will possess strong clinical skills, be passionate about delivering exceptional care, and enjoy mentoring other team members. This role involves handling a varied caseload and providing excellent client care. The practice values wellness and offers a supportive environment with numerous professional development opportunities.
